SQLде NOT LIKE оператору барбы?
SQLде NOT LIKE оператору барбы?

Video: SQLде NOT LIKE оператору барбы?

Video: SQLде NOT LIKE оператору барбы?
Video: Урок 13 -Оператор LIKE (SQL для Начинающих) 2024, Ноябрь
Anonim

SQLдеги NOT LIKE оператору varchar түрүндөгү тилкеде колдонулат. Адатта, ал көрсөтүү үчүн колдонулган % менен колдонулат каалаган сап мааниси, анын ичинде the нөлдүк белги. The сапты биз буга өткөрүп беребиз оператор болуп саналат жок тамга сезгич.

Демек, SQLдеги оператор КАНДАЙ БОЛОТ?

The SQL Server ЖАКШЫ логикалык болуп саналат оператор ал белги сап белгиленген үлгүгө дал келээрин аныктайт. Үлгү кадимки символдорду жана коймо белгилерди камтышы мүмкүн. The LIKE оператору WHERE колдонулат пункт үлгү дал келүүсүнүн негизинде катарларды чыпкалоо үчүн SELECT, UPDATE жана DELETE операторлорунун.

Андан тышкары, SQLде эмнени колдонуу керек? The SQL IN шарты (кээде IN оператору деп аталат) туюнтма маанилердин тизмесиндеги кандайдыр бир мааниге дал келгенин оңой текшерүүгө мүмкүндүк берет. бул колдонулган SELECT, INSERT, UPDATE же DELETE билдирүүлөрүндө бир нече ЖЕ шарттарына болгон муктаждыкты азайтууга жардам берүү.

Ошо сыяктуу эле, SQLди кантип жактырбайм?

Үлгү керек жок түз сап бол. Мисалы, ал сап туюнтмасы же таблица тилкеси катары көрсөтүлүшү мүмкүн. Пер SQL стандарттык, ЖАКШЫ ар бир белгинин негизинде дал келүүнү жүзөгө ашырат, ошентип ал = салыштыруу операторунан башкача натыйжаларды чыгара алат. ЖАКШЫ оператор үлгүгө дал келүү үчүн WILDCARDS (б.а. %, _) колдонот.

SQLде билдирүү ЭМЕС?

The SQL ЭМЕС оператор ЭМЕС логикалык болуп саналат SQLде оператор ар кандай шарттын алдына коюуга болот билдирүү ал үчүн саптарды тандоо билдирүү жалган. Жогорудагы учурда, сиз жыл_ранасы кайсы натыйжаларды көрө аласыз барабар 2 же 3кө чейин жок камтылган. ЖОК көбүнчө LIKE менен колдонулат.

Сунушталууда: